Crawlspace water cleanup services involve the removal of excess moisture and standing water from beneath a building’s floor. This process typically includes extracting water, drying the area thoroughly, and addressing any residual dampness that could lead to further issues. Proper water cleanup is essential to prevent m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age, ensuring the crawlspace remains a dry and stable environment. Service providers may also inspect for leaks or sources of water intrusion to help prevent future problems.
These services are particularly valuable in solving problems associated with water intrusion, such as flooding caused by heavy rains, plumbing leaks, or groundwater seepage. Excess moisture in crawlspaces can create an environment conducive to mold development and attract pests like termites and rodents. By removing water and thoroughly drying the area, cleanup professionals help mitigate health risks and protect the integrity of the property’s foundation and framing.

Cost of Water Extraction - Typically ranges from $500 to $1,500 depending on the extent of water intrusion and size of the crawlspace. For example, minor water removal may cost closer to $500, while extensive flooding can reach higher amounts.
Drying and Dehumidification Expenses - Usually costs between $300 and $1,200 to dry out a crawlspace after water cleanup. Larger areas or severe moisture issues tend to increase the overall cost.
Mold Remediation Costs - Mold removal services following water damage generally fall within $1,000 to $3,000. The price varies based on mold severity and the size of the affected area.
Additional Repairs and Cleanup - Repairing damaged insulation, flooring, or vapor barriers can add $200 to $2,000 to the total cost. The final expense depends on the extent of structural repairs need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water in a crawlspace? Water in a crawlspace can result from heavy rainfall, groundwater seepage, plumbing leaks, or poor drainage around the property.
How can water damage in a crawlspace be addressed? Local service providers typically assess the extent of water intrusion, remove standing water, and implement solutions like drainage improvements or moisture barriers.
Is mold a concern after water intrusion in a crawlspace? Yes, excess moisture can lead to mold growth, which specialists can identify and remediate during cleanup services.
What are common methods for crawlspace water cleanup? Professionals often use water extraction, drying equipment, and moisture control techniques to restore the area.
How can I prevent future water issues in my crawlspace? Proper drainage, sealing foundation cracks, and installing vapor barriers can help reduce the risk of water intrusion.
